Arts Collection Assistant The Billy Ireland Cartoon Library & Museum Art Collections Assistant will support the work of collections management, with a primary focus on processing original art materials from recently acquired large cartoon art collections. Creates item-level descriptive records in the CGA Past Perfect database using metadata standards. Organizes and prepares material for storage following archival standards. The Project Assistant will be responsible for organizing and processing these visual art collection and input information into data management systems. Work in this position will heavily utilize Past Perfect, as well as other metadata management tools in use by OSUL. This position works under the general supervision of the Curator for Collections, in consultation with the Head Curator of the Billy Ireland Cartoon Library & Museum. Consults and collaborates with others throughout the library as appropriate. Required Qualifications • Bachelor of Arts in Arts or Humanities • At least 1- year experience in Special Collections, Archives, or Art Collection • Ability to work effectively with diverse groups, including cataloguers, and other library professionals, student workers, and systems/information technology staff; • Experience producing clear, effective writing; strong organizational skills; • Ability to follow instructions and complete complex tasks with a high degree of accuracy; • Effective oral communication skills; • Experience using Past Perfect Software or other content management software • Frequently works in archival storage conditions where temperatures are approximately 62 degrees F; • Must be able to lift 40 lbs. and push carts weighing up to 80 lbs. Desired Qualifications • Knowledge of cartoon and comic history • Experience processing collections of visual materials. • Experience handling artworks on paper Application Please submit cover letter and resume with the online application at https://osu.wd1.myworkdayjobs.com/OSUCareers/job/Columbus-Campus/Art-CollectionsAssistant_R69998.
